Abstract

Ischemic heart disease is one of the main causes of death all over the world. Clinically, causing myocardial infarction is fatal in adults mainly due to atherosclerotic changes in the coronary arteries and sudden vascular spasm caused by stress in young people, in many cases for failure to provide timely treatment measures. Research conducted by the most recent epidemiological taxing professors Khan M, Hashim M, Mustafa H on global disease from 2010 to 2020 shows that cardiac ischemic diseases affect about 126 million people worldwide (1,655 per 100,000 people), accounting for 1.72% of the world's population by country and region, causing 34.4 million and 17.4 million deaths respectively. Males are more likely to be observed compared to females at present at 1,655 per 100,000 population, increasing from 1,845 by 2030. Among the countries of Eastern Europe, the highest incidence is maintained.
